The United States of America, acting through the Millennium Challenge Corporation (“MCC”), and Sierra Leone (the “Government”) signed a Threshold Program Grant Agreement (the “Agreement”) pursuant to which MCC agreed to provide a grant of up to US$ 44,400,000 to the Government for a Sierra Leone Threshold Program to reduce poverty through economic growth in Sierra Leone.

The MCC is a US foreign aid agency that is helping countries fight widespread poverty through economic growth. The MCC assesses over two hundred countries annually that are either LICs or LMICs on a competitive basis. To be selected, a country must pass a minimum of ten out of twenty governance related indicators including those of “political rights” and “control of corruption”.
